[citation][nom]omnimodis78[/nom]What does "pleading the fifth" mean? I really don't know.[/citation]

"The fifth amendment protects witnesses from being forced to incriminate themselves. To "plead the Fifth" is to refuse to answer a question because the response could provide self-incriminating evidence of an illegal conduct punished by fines, penalties or forfeiture."
